The fashion industry is a profligate source of pollution, even when making baby clothing. Lauren Gregor founded Rent-a-Room to help parents find and reuse baby clothing. During the first years of a baby’s life, they change sizes and styles faster than a teenage fashion plate. Gregor, a new mom, decided to follow the fashion rental examples of Rent-the-Runway and StitchFix, introducing a subscription service the provides curated “capsules” of baby and toddler clothes. Available in a 7-item Just the Essentials Capsule and 15-item Complete Capsule, Rent-a-Romper’s customers can return clothing whenever baby outgrows it.<br /><br />Gregor estimates that instead of using and tossing out baby clothes after a single use, Rent-a-Romper can extend the use of an item up to or beyond a half-dozen uses. Lost items or those that parents want to keep do not cost extra. Gregor’s company also offers subscriptions to branded clothing through partnerships with children’s clothing makers.<br /><br />Do you have used baby clothes you’d like to see reused?
